AI was mentioned only once on this call, in a brief and vague reference by CEO Mike Creedon during the Q&A when discussing marketing capabilities. He stated that Dollar Tree is 'leveraging elements of AI throughout our business to really get to know our customer better,' framing it as a tool supporting data-driven customer understanding and targeted marketing. No specific AI products, vendors, investments, or quantified outcomes were disclosed.
